> +static void dcache_hash_resize(unsigned int new_shift);
> +static void mod_nr_dentry(int mod)
> +{
> +     unsigned long dentry_size;
> +
> +     dentry_stat.nr_dentry += mod;
> +
> +     dentry_size = 1 << dentry_hash->shift;
> +     if (unlikely(dentry_stat.nr_dentry > dentry_size+(dentry_size>>1)))
> +             dcache_hash_resize(dentry_hash->shift+1);
> +     else if (unlikely(dentry_stat.nr_dentry < (dentry_size>>1)))
> +             dcache_hash_resize(dentry_hash->shift-1);
> +}
> +

Do we need to do this kind of resizing in implicit automatic way ?
I think it's good to show contention rate by /proc and add sysctl for
resize this.
